La situation dans laquelle la réparation ne fonctionne pas dans MS Access peut sembler frustrante pour de nombreux utilisateurs. Ce problème survient fréquemment lorsqu’une base de données Access devient endommagée ou corrompue, rendant l’accès à ses données complexe, voire impossible. La réparation ne fonctionne pas dans MS Access indique généralement que la méthode de réparation standard n’a pas réussi à restaurer la base de données à un état fonctionnel. Cela peut résulter de plusieurs facteurs techniques liés soit à la structure des fichiers Access, soit à des conflits logiciels.
Points Clés à Retenir
- Comprendre le Problème : La réparation de MS Access peut échouer pour diverses raisons, notamment des fichiers corrompus, des conflits de compatibilité ou des erreurs dans les mises à jour.
- Solutions à Rechercher : Identifier les causes possibles et suivre un guide étape par étape peut aider à résoudre le problème.
- Meilleures Pratiques : Prendre des mesures préventives peut réduire les risques de corruption de la base de données.
Causes Possibles
Fichiers Corrompus
Les fichiers de base de données peuvent se corrompre en raison de pannes de courant, de fermetures inappropriées ou d’erreurs d’application. Une fois corrompus, les outils de réparation standard peuvent ne pas réussir à restaurer l’intégrité des données.
Conflits de Compatibilité
Les nouvelles versions de Microsoft Access peuvent parfois présenter des problèmes de compatibilité avec des bases de données créées dans des versions précédentes. Cela peut inclure des fonctionnalités non supportées ou des erreurs de formatage.
Erreurs de Mises à Jour
Les mises à jour logicielles peuvent introduire de nouvelles erreurs qui perturbent le fonctionnement de la base de données.
Problèmes de Permissions
Des permissions insuffisantes peuvent également rendre la base de données inaccessible, empêchant la réparation même si les fichiers ne sont pas corrompus.
Guide de Dépannage Étape par Étape
Étape 1 : Sauvegarder la Base de Données
Avant d’effectuer toute réparation, sauvegardez votre base de données actuelle. Cela garantit que vous pouvez revenir à un état précédent en cas d’échec des réparations.
Étape 2 : Compacter et Réparer
- Ouvrez MS Access.
- Allez dans le menu Fichier puis Informations.
- Sélectionnez Compacter et Réparer la Base de Données.
Cette option crée une copie de la base de données compactée et peut résoudre les problèmes de fragmentation.
Étape 3 : Utiliser l’outil JetComp
Microsoft propose l’outil JetCompact pour réparer des fichiers de base de données .mdb. Telechargez cet outil et suivez ces étapes :
- Exécutez l’outil.
- Choisissez le fichier de base de données à réparer.
- Laissez le processus se terminer.
Étape 4 : Créer une Nouvelle Base de Données
Si la réparation échoue, envisagez de créer une nouvelle base de données :
- Créez une nouvelle base de données vide.
- Importez les objets (tables, requêtes, formulaires) un à un depuis la base de données endommagée.
Cela évite de transférer les erreurs possibles.
Étape 5 : Utiliser des Scripts de Réparation
Utiliser un script VBA (Visual Basic for Applications) peut parfois résoudre les problèmes plus profonds. Vous pouvez écrire un script simple pour vérifier l’intégrité ou récupérer des données spécifiques.
Erreurs Courantes et Comment les Éviter
Erreurs de Sauvegarde
Assurez-vous toujours de conserver des sauvegardes fréquentes et automatiques, car la perte de données peut survenir à tout moment.
Mises à Jour d’Access
Ne mettez pas à jour votre logiciel sans d’abord vérifier sa compatibilité avec vos bases de données existantes. Testez les mises à jour sur un environnement non productif.
Fermeture Impromptue
Évitez de fermer le programme Access ou l’ordinateur de manière brutale. Utilisez toujours le système de fermeture correct.
Conseils de Prévention
- Effectuer des Sauvegardes Régulières : Planifiez des sauvegardes automatiques pour minimiser le risque de perte de données.
- Utiliser une Version à Jour : Gardez votre logiciel MS Access à jour pour réduire les vulnérabilités et bugs.
- Vérifier les Permissions : Révisez régulièrement les paramètres de sécurité et assurez-vous que toutes les permissions nécessaires sont en place.
FAQ
Comment savoir si une base de données est vraiment corrompue ?
Si vous ne pouvez pas ouvrir la base de données, que vous recevez des messages d’erreur fréquents ou que les données ne s’affichent pas correctement, il est probable que la base soit corrompue.
Que faire si la réparation ne fonctionne pas après plusieurs tentatives ?
Si les réparations échouent, envisagez d’utiliser un logiciel tiers spécialisé dans la récupération de données Access ou contactez un expert en base de données.
Quels outils tiers recommandez-vous pour réparer Access ?
Des outils comme Stellar Repair for Access ou AccessFIX peuvent être efficaces. Assurez-vous de lire des critiques et tester des versions d’essai.
Est-ce que compacter la base de données peut résoudre d’autres problèmes ?
Oui, la fonction de compactage peut non seulement réparer des fichiers corrompus, mais aussi améliorer les performances et réduire la taille de la base de données.
Que faire si mes données sont toujours manquantes après la réparation ?
Vous devrez peut-être contacter un spécialiste de la récupération de données. Il existe aussi des options de récupération dans des sauvegardes antérieures.
En conclusion, la réparation ne fonctionne pas dans MS Access peut résulter de diverses causes, mais en suivant une approche systématique et en mettant en place des meilleures pratiques, vous pouvez souvent résoudre le problème ou le prévenir à l’avenir. Les solutions incluent des méthodes intégrées de réparation, l’importation dans une nouvelle base de données et l’utilisation d’outils spécialisés. Assurez-vous de suivre les conseils de sécurité et de sauvegarde pour éviter que cela ne se reproduise.
